Is a candle business a good business idea?

Kasspian’s honest read

4/10Doable with an edge

A fine side income but a hard real business, because candles are cheap to make and everyone is making them, so you live or die on brand and distribution.

Who actually pays

Gift buyers and people decorating a space or a mood — they're paying for the scent, the look on a shelf, and the feeling, often as a present for someone else. Loyalty is shallow unless your brand earns it.

Riskiest assumption

That you can stand out in a category drowning in near-identical products. The making is easy and well-documented; getting chosen over a thousand other pretty jars is the actual challenge.

Cheapest test first

Pour a small first batch and try to sell it at a local market or to your own network before scaling. Watch whether people buy a second time or refer a friend — repeat pull is the signal that matters.

The honest take

Candles are the classic 'easy to start' business, and that's both the appeal and the problem. The supplies are cheap, the process is forgiving, and there are endless tutorials — which means your competition is effectively infinite and growing daily. On the raw product, there's almost nothing to defend. Two candles with the same scent and a similar jar are interchangeable to a buyer, so price gets squeezed and margins thin out fast once you're paying for ads, packaging, and shipping a heavy, fragile item.

The candle makers who do well aren't really selling wax — they're selling a brand, an aesthetic, or a story that makes their jar the one you pick. A strong identity, a tight niche, a memorable name, or an existing audience can turn a commodity into something people seek out and gift repeatedly. If you've got that, candles are a reasonable vehicle. If your plan is 'good scents, nice labels, and hope,' expect a slow grind where the candles are simple and the customers are the hard part.
